Choosing Your Niche
One of the most important steps in making money on Kindle is selecting the right niche. This involves identifying a topic or genre that you are passionate about and that has a demand in the market. Here are some tips to help you choose your niche:
- Research popular genres and topics on Amazon’s Kindle store.
- Consider your own expertise and interests.
- Look for gaps in the market where you can offer unique content.

Optimizing Your Book for Search
Optimizing your book for search is crucial to increase visibility in the Kindle store. Here are some tips:
- Choose a compelling title and subtitle.
- Write a compelling book description that highlights your book’s unique selling points.
- Incorporate relevant keywords in your title, subtitle, and description.
Pricing Your Book
Pricing your book is a delicate balance between maximizing your earnings and remaining competitive. Here are some factors to consider:
- Research the pricing of similar books in your niche.
- Consider the length and quality of your book.
- Offer a discounted price for your book during the launch period.

Generating Revenue
There are several ways to generate revenue from your Kindle books:
- Direct sales through the Kindle store.
- Offer your book in print-on-demand format through Amazon’s CreateSpace.
- License your content to other publishers or platforms.
Table: Kindle Book Revenue Streams
Revenue Stream | Description |
---|---|
Kindle Direct Publishing (KDP) | Direct sales of eBooks through Amazon’s Kindle store. |
CreateSpace | Print-on-demand (POD) services for physical copies of your book. |
Licensing | Granting permission to other publishers or platforms to use your content. |
